Attendance and leave

Record working time, review leave and understand reserved days.

Prepare company rules

Owners and administrators manage attendance corrections, leave decisions, policies and individual annual allowances. Set the company timezone, working week, start time and holidays first. Leave allowances are company configuration, not an automatic interpretation of Lebanese employment law. Members linked to an employee see their own records and can submit their own leave requests.

Clock in or record attendance

Linked employees can check in and out using the current time. An earlier open shift must be closed or corrected before another starts. Managers can record or correct a dated attendance record with explanatory notes. Present and half-day records require working times; breaks must be shorter than the recorded interval. Future attendance is rejected. Late minutes use the configured company start time.

Request and review leave

  1. Choose an active leave type, start and end dates, and a reason. The request counts configured working days and excludes company holidays.
  2. Pending requests reserve allowance before approval. Overlapping pending or approved requests are rejected; a cross-year request checks each year separately.
  3. A manager reviews the request with a decision note. Recorded work on its leave dates must be corrected before approval.
  4. Employees may withdraw pending requests. Ask a manager to cancel approved leave. Rejected or cancelled requests are not edited into a different period; submit a new request.

Read balances and correct conflicts

Used days are approved leave; reserved days are pending requests. Remaining allowance subtracts both when the policy requires a balance. Later holiday or schedule changes do not recalculate saved leave dates. Cancel or correct approved leave before recording work on those dates. Attendance is not a payroll payment or an automatic statutory deduction calculation.
